Copilot was bamboozled into revealing how to hack itself, security researchers claim: 'Copilot wasn’t…

Security researchers at Varonis Threat Labs have discovered a vulnerability in Microsoft's Copilot AI, dubbed 'CoSnitch.' By persistently questioning the AI, they were able to trick it into revealing details about its internal architecture and an undocumented URL parameter that allowed for unauthorized prompt execution. Varonis disclosed the issue to Microsoft in December, and it was patched on August 18, though the researchers warn the 'meta-hacking' technique could be applied to other agentic AI platforms.
